Reduced forecast for soybean and corn production in Brazil

The soybean production forecast in Brazil has been reduced by 3.9 million tons due to decreased planting density and unfavorable weather conditions. The corn production forecast has also been decreased by 1.4 million tons due to low soil moisture and unfavorable growing conditions.

Due to a decrease in soybean planting density in the largest oilseed producing states, Refinitiv Commodities Research analysts reduced their forecast for soybean production in Brazil by 3.9 million tons in 2023/24 MY. Production is now expected to be 149.3 million tons, down 5.3 million tons from the previous forecast.

In addition, weather conditions in the central-western and south-eastern regions of Brazil have been unfavorable over the past two weeks. Abnormal heat was observed everywhere except the south, and precipitation was well below average.

Also, due to low soil moisture and unfavorable weather conditions for the development of corn crops of the second harvest, the forecast for safrigna production in 2023/24 MY was reduced by 1.4 million tons. Production is now expected to be 119.2 million tons, up 12.7 million tons from a year earlier.
